Hotel Arcantis Le Voltaire sells fast on our site. Hotel Voltaire is just a few minutes from central Rennes, and half a mile from the train station. It offers rooms with private bathrooms in a quiet green area.
Guest rooms come with flat-screen TV and free Wi-Fi internet access. They provide a comfortable and functional living space.
The hotel serves a buffet breakfast during the week and on weekends. It also has a cozy bar where you can enjoy a relaxing drink with family or friends.
Hotel Voltaire is a 15 minute walk from Stade de la Route de Lorient and just 2 miles from the Museum of Fine Arts of Rennes.
